System Health
One number that tells you if your system is ready to ship.
PULSAR continuously computes a System Health Index from three inputs: observed behavior patterns, dependency complexity, and open anomaly history. The result is a single, auditable view of system maturity — by domain, by component, by program. Not gut feeling. Not war room consensus. A data-driven readiness score that supports Go/No-Go decisions with evidence.
